Cons
I left after over a year because things were changing for the worse and my efforts were unappreciated. 1. Company-wide, the rollout of Eviden was messy: names changed with little notice, comms to clients were rushed and embarrassing due to all the acquisition changes, and I felt like the Maven Wave culture was getting shelved in order to fit in with our new owners. 2. My team in particular suffered greatly when an entire team we collaborated with on a daily basis left the company one by one, and we were left to pick up the slack. My job scope changed completely and suddenly required a new set of skills I did not have. I spoke to my boss for clarity and was told it was temporary, and that the company would soon hire new employees to fix the gap and rebuild the broken team we worked with. This did not happen and it became clear that it was never going to happen. 3. I got a 1% raise after acing my annual performance review. My client base had quadrupled and my job scope had completely changed.
